p-channel mosfet switching circuit

There's no problem driving the gate direct from the Arduino pin (perhaps a 150 ohm
resistor in series). That MOSFET works from 2.7V drive up so having the
gate at 0V and the source at 3.7V will be adequate drive. Pulling the gate voltage
above the source will simply turn it even more off.

Of course that configuration is active low from the Arduino's perspective.

A downside is that the MOSFET will be ON if the Arduino is powered down
And the LiPo is still connected.
